Как решить такую задачу? Есть сервер на FreeBSD, через него локальная сеть в интернет выходит. У сервера соответсвенно два сетевых интерфеса. rl0(в инет) и wd0(в локалку). Необходимо запустить с заранее известного IP человека и перенаправить его на машину 192.168.1.112. Можно ли осуществить сиё с помощью ipfw?
> Как решить такую задачу? Есть сервер на FreeBSD, через него локальная
>сеть в интернет выходит. У сервера соответсвенно два сетевых интерфеса. rl0(в
>инет) и wd0(в локалку). Необходимо запустить с заранее известного IP человека
>и перенаправить его на машину 192.168.1.112. Можно ли осуществить сиё с
>помощью ipfw?
%$#@%$@ :)
тут кто нибудь ЧАВО пишет???!!!!!man natd - вобщем
> Как решить такую задачу? Есть сервер на FreeBSD, через него локальная
>сеть в интернет выходит. У сервера соответсвенно два сетевых интерфеса. rl0(в
>инет) и wd0(в локалку). Необходимо запустить с заранее известного IP человека
>и перенаправить его на машину 192.168.1.112. Можно ли осуществить сиё с
>помощью ipfw?Как в БСД не знаю
а в линухе через DNAT
> Как решить такую задачу? Есть сервер на FreeBSD, через него локальная
>сеть в интернет выходит. У сервера соответсвенно два сетевых интерфеса. rl0(в
>инет) и wd0(в локалку). Необходимо запустить с заранее известного IP человека
>и перенаправить его на машину 192.168.1.112. Можно ли осуществить сиё с
>помощью ipfw?ipfw add xyz fwd 192.168.1.112 tcp from <local_ip> to <your_server_ip>
не пойдёт?
>> Как решить такую задачу? Есть сервер на FreeBSD, через него локальная
>>сеть в интернет выходит. У сервера соответсвенно два сетевых интерфеса. rl0(в
>>инет) и wd0(в локалку). Необходимо запустить с заранее известного IP человека
>>и перенаправить его на машину 192.168.1.112. Можно ли осуществить сиё с
>>помощью ipfw?
>
>ipfw add xyz fwd 192.168.1.112 tcp from <local_ip> to <your_server_ip>
>
>не пойдёт?
Пасибо! Работает!Вот только одна поправочка
ipfw add xyz fwd 192.168.1.112 tcp from <external_ip> to <your_server_ip>